The coffee & drinks Hawthorne scene can feel scattered at times, but here, it all blends naturally. There’s no pressure to commit to just one vibe. You can post up with your laptop and a cold brew, then shift into chill mode with a beer as the sun dips low.
And speaking of cold brew—yes, they have it, and it’s delicious. Their beans come from local roasters, often rotating like their beer taps. Even if you're a hardcore espresso-only person, the baristas here know how to make you something smooth, bold, and far from generic.
